U.S. Aid to Israel Totals $233.7b Over Six Decades

Moshe Arens: Generous assistance reflects common strategic interests and values, rather than lobbying pressure.

The United States has provided Israel with $233.7 billion in aid ‏(after adjusting for inflation‏) since the state was formed in 1948 through the end of last year, research by TheMarker has found.
